android - 镜像(翻转)一个 View/ProgressBar

标签 android android-widget android-progressbar material-components-android progress-indicator

我有一个自定义的圆形进度条,用于时钟上的秒计数器,我想翻转它,以便时钟逆时针计数。

在这里搜索解决方案,我发现了这个:

Right to Left ProgressBar?

这显然适用于水平进度条,但我不能简单地将它旋转 180 度,因为那样只会将时钟移动 180 度,它仍会顺时针滴答作响。

是否有任何其他方式来镜像 ProgressBar 或任何 View ?

编辑:

刚刚找到“android:rotationY”和编程等效项,但这理想情况下需要用于 2.2 及更高版本..

最佳答案

我能够简单地使用 XML 中的属性 scaleX 翻转 ProgressBar:

android:scaleX="-1"

这也适用于其他 View

关于android - 镜像(翻转)一个 View/ProgressBar,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14022298/

相关文章:

Android RatingBar 怪异 : Whenever I add a RatingBar to my layout, 一堆生成的标签,抛出错误,就好像它们是未定义的

android - 自定义水平进度条背景

android - WebView 在加载进度条时显示为白色

Android - 我有一个带有 BroadcastReceiver 的应用程序,用于在 notif 中弹出的提醒。区域。如何添加服务?

android - 如何删除 Android 中标签小部件的间距?

Android位图颜色实时修改

java - 进度条未显示在 webview 的 Relativelayout 中

javascript - react native : elevation (shadow) and transparency on button don't work together as needed

安卓 4.4 : Bluetooth Low Energy; Connect without scanning for a BLE device

android - 如何将真实的应用程序对象与 Android 的 ServiceTestCase 一起使用